Meaning: Automotive fuel injectors are precision-engineered components responsible for delivering fuel into the combustion chamber of an internal combustion engine. They replace traditional carburetors, offering improved fuel efficiency, precise fuel delivery, and better control over combustion processes. Fuel injectors play a critical role in optimizing engine performance and meeting stringent emission standards.

Segmentation: The Automotive Fuel Injectors Market can be segmented based on various factors, including:
- Fuel Injection Type: Port Fuel Injection (PFI), Direct Fuel Injection (GDI), Sequential Fuel Injection, and Throttle Body Injection.
- Vehicle Type: Passenger Vehicles, Commercial Vehicles, Electric Vehicles, and Hybrid Vehicles.
- Fuel Type: Gasoline, Diesel, CNG (Compressed Natural Gas), and Others.
- End-User: OEMs (Original Equipment Manufacturers) and Aftermarket.

Category-wise Insights:
- Direct Fuel Injection (GDI) Systems: GDI systems, known for their precision and efficiency, are gaining prominence, especially in passenger vehicles, contributing to improved fuel economy and reduced emissions.
- Port Fuel Injection (PFI) Systems: PFI systems continue to be widely used, particularly in entry-level and mid-range vehicles, providing a balance between cost-effectiveness and performance.
- Fuel Injectors for Electric Vehicles: While electric vehicles have electric drivetrains, some hybrid models still incorporate fuel injection systems, creating a niche market for specialized fuel injectors.
- Aftermarket Fuel Injector Upgrades: Enthusiasts and tuners seek aftermarket fuel injectors to enhance engine performance, presenting opportunities for manufacturers to offer upgraded and high-performance fuel injection solutions.
